The Correct Connections

Once the answer was revealed, everything made perfect sense. Here's how each clue connects:

  • Mousetrap (Mousetrap spring): A mousetrap uses a spring mechanism to quickly snap shut when triggered, effectively capturing mice.
  • Mechanical watch (Winding the mechanical watch): Mechanical watches rely on a mainspring that must be wound to keep accurate time, showcasing their dependence on springs for functionality.
  • Stapler (Stapler spring): A stapler contains a spring mechanism that helps to drive the staple through papers, allowing them to be fastened together.
  • Clothespin (spring-loaded clothespin): A clothespin operates using a spring mechanism that allows it to grip items securely.
  • Trampoline (Bouncing on a trampoline): A trampoline is a device designed for jumping and performing acrobatics, which relies on springs to provide the rebound effect.
